Village of Lowville Awards Professional Services Contract to New York Conference of Mayors (nycom) (April 2026)

The Village of Lowville Board approved Resolution 2026-5 authorizing officials and staff to attend New York Conference of Mayors (NYCOM) training events beginning April 1, 2026. This standing authorization covers participation in NYCOM’s annual, fiscal, and public works training programs as needed.
